FST Corp. ($KBSX) reported second-quarter 2026 revenue of $12.6 million, up 13.1% from a year earlier, while gross profit climbed 17.7% to $6.0 million. The company also ended the quarter with $8.2 million in cash and cash equivalents, a 20.9% increase from the prior year.
Profitability remained under pressure. Operating profit fell to $0.3 million, and net loss attributable to common shareholders widened to $1.0 million, or ($0.02) per diluted share. Cost of sales rose 9.2% to $6.5 million, even as total liabilities declined 6.4% to $46.9 million.
